Understanding the Role of Nintendo of America
Nintendo of America (NOA) is the division of Nintendo that oversees the company’s operations in North America, including the United States, Canada, and Mexico. It is a vital hub for the company’s marketing, distribution, and development efforts across the continent. Located in Redmond, Washington, the headquarters is not just a functional space but also a symbol of Nintendo’s significant presence in the gaming world.
For years, the company has shaped the video game industry through innovations like the NES, Super Nintendo, and, more recently, the Nintendo Switch. The headquarters in Redmond plays a pivotal role in ensuring these products are brought to North American markets and reach millions of fans.
The Location of Nintendo of America Headquarters
The Nintendo of America headquarters is situated in Redmond, Washington, just outside of Seattle. This location was chosen due to its proximity to major technological hubs and its accessibility for distribution across North America. In fact, Redmond is home to some of the largest tech companies in the world, making it an ideal spot for Nintendo’s operations.
Building the Legacy: History of Nintendo of America
The story of Nintendo of America began in 1980 when the company first made its entry into the North American market. Originally, Nintendo of America was a small operation working to bring arcade games to the United States. Over the years, however, it expanded its scope and influence, eventually becoming the dominant force in the video game industry that it is today.
In the early 1980s, Nintendo launched its first major product in the U.S., the Nintendo Entertainment System (NES), which quickly became a household name. This success marked the beginning of Nintendo’s growth in the North American market, and the establishment of its headquarters in Redmond cemented its commitment to the region.

Can I visit Nintendo of America Headquarters?
Unfortunately, the Nintendo of America headquarters is not open to the public. While the company occasionally hosts events for fans and partners, the headquarters is primarily a working facility for employees.
